Explanation
BACKGROUND: For the option to purchase Highway Rock Salt for the Department of Public Service, the largest user, and for other City agencies as needed. Highway Rock Salt is used for snow and ice removal.
The term of the proposed option contract would be one (1) year. Contract is through July 31, 2010. The Purchasing Office opened formal bids on July 19, 2009.
The Purchasing Office advertised and solicited competitive bids in accordance with Section 329.06 (Solicitation SA003311) twenty four (MBE:4, FBE:1) bids were solicited; A total of three (3) bid proposals (MBE:0, FBE:0) were received.
The Purchasing Office is recommending award of contracts to the lowest, responsive, responsible and best bidder as follows:
American Rock Salt Co. LLC CC#161516458 (Expires 08/25/2011)
Total Estimated Annual Expenditure: $ 2,000,000.00
This company is not debarred according to the Federal Excluded Parties Listing or the State Auditor's Findings For Recovery Database.
This ordinance is being submitted as an emergency because, without emergency action, no less than 37 days will be added to this procurement cycle and the efficient delivery of valuable public services will be slowed.
FISCAL IMPACT: Funding to establish this option contract is budgeted in the Mail, Print Services and UTC Fund.
Title
To authorize and direct the Finance & Management Director to enter into one (1) UTC contract for the option to purchase Highway Rock Salt UTC with American Rock Salt Co. LLC, to authorize the expenditure of $1.00 to establish the contract from the Mail, Print Services and UTC Fund; and to declare an emergency. ($1.00)
Body
WHEREAS, the Purchasing Office advertised and solicited formal bids on July 19, 2009 and selected the lowest, responsive, responsible and best bid. Three (3) bids were received; and
WHEREAS, this ordinance addresses Purchasing objective of 1) maximizing the use of City resources by obtaining optimal products/services at low prices and 2) encouraging economic development by improving access to City bid opportunities and 3) providing effective option contracts for City agencies to efficiently maintain their supply chain and service to the public; and
WHEREAS, Highway Rock Salt UTC will be used for snow and ice removal by the Department of Public Service, this is being submitted for consideration as an emergency measure; and
WHEREAS, an emergency exists in the usual daily operation of the Purchasing Office in that it is immediately necessary to enter into one (1) contract for an option to purchase Highway Rock Salt Services to ensure uninterrupted supply of materials and services, thereby preserving the public health, peace, property, safety, and welfare; now, therefore,
B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F COLUMBUS:
SECTION 1. That the Finance & Management Director be and is hereby authorized and directed to enter into the following contract for an option to purchase Highway Rock Salt Services with Solicitation SA003311; contract is through July 31, 2010.
American Rock Salt Co. LLC,, Awarded all items; Amount $1.00.
SECTION 2. That the expenditure of $1.00 is hereby authorized from the Mail, Print Services and UTC Fund, Organization Level 1: 45-01, Fund: 05-517, Object Level 3: 2270, OCA: 451130, to pay the cost thereof.
SECTION 3. That for the reason stated in the preamble here to, which is hereby made a part hereof, this ordinance is hereby declared to be an emergency measure and shall take effect and be in force from and after its passage and approval by the Mayor, or ten days after passage if the Mayor neither approves nor vetoes the same.
